How they compare
Romania currently reports 0.7825 GPIA against 0.6765 GPIA in Armenia, a difference of 0.106 GPIA.
That makes Romania's figure about 1.2 times Armenia's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 11 shared years of data; in 2013 it was Armenia ahead.
Armenia ranks 59th and Romania ranks 56th of 70 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Armenia averaged higher in 1 and Romania in 1.
